兰大《面向对象程序设计》18春平时作业1辅导资料

兰大《面向对象程序设计》18春平时作业1辅导资料

ID:17400475

大小:13.74 KB

页数:4页

时间:2018-08-30

兰大《面向对象程序设计》18春平时作业1辅导资料_第1页
兰大《面向对象程序设计》18春平时作业1辅导资料_第2页
兰大《面向对象程序设计》18春平时作业1辅导资料_第3页
兰大《面向对象程序设计》18春平时作业1辅导资料_第4页
资源描述:

《兰大《面向对象程序设计》18春平时作业1辅导资料》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、兰大《面向对象程序设计》18春平时作业11、C2、C3、C4、A5、D一、单选题共13题,52分1、以下关于函数模板叙述正确的是A函数模板也是一个具体类型的函数B函数模板的类型参数与函数的参数是同一个概念C通过使用不同的类型参数,函数模板可以生成不同类型的函数D用函数模板定义的函数没有类型正确答案是:C2、下列有关继承和派生的叙述中,正确的是()A派生类不能访问基类的保护成员B作为虚基类的类不能被实例化C派生类应当向基类的构造函数传递参数D虚函数必须在派生类中重新实现正确答案是:C3、在文件包含命令中,被包含文

2、件的扩展名A必须是.hB不能是.hC可以是.h或.cppD必须是.cpp正确答案是:C4、下列有关运算符重载的叙述中,正确的是()A运算符重载是多态性的一种表现BC++中可以通过运算符重载创造新的运算符CC++中所有运算符都可以作为非成员函数重载D重载运算符时可以改变其结合性正确答案是:A5、下面()不是抽象类的特征A可以说明纯虚函数B不能说明抽象类的对象C用作基类,提供公用的接口D可以定义虚构造函数正确答案是:D6、要使语句“p=newint[10][20]”正确,p应事先定义为Aint*pBint**pCi

3、nt*p[20]Dint(*p)[20]正确答案是:D7、以下哪个关键字对应的属性破坏了程序的封装性()AconstBfriendCpublicDprotected正确答案是:B8、一个类的构造函数通常被定义为该类的()成员A公用B保护C私有D友元正确答案是:A9、以下不合法的数值常量是()A011BlelC8.0E0.5D0xabcd正确答案是:C10、对于一个类的构造函数,其函数名与类名A完全相同B基本相同C不相同D无关系正确答案是:A11、已知Value是一个类,Value是Value的一个对象。下列以非

4、成员函数形式重载的运算符函数原形中,正确的是()AValueoperator+(Valuev,inti)BValueoperator+(Valuev=value,inti)CValueoperator+(Valuev,inti=0)DValueoperator+(Valuev=value,inti=0)正确答案是:B12、以下程序中,错误的行是①#include②classA③{④public:⑤intn=2:⑥A(intval){cout<

5、⑨voidmain()⑩{⑩Aa(0);⑩}()A⑤B⑥C⑦D⑩正确答案是:A13、解决二义性问题的方法有A只能使用作用域分辨操作符B使用作用域分辨操作符或赋值兼容规则C使用作用域分辨操作符或虚基类D使用虚基类或赋值兼容规则正确答案是:C二、多选题共2题,8分1、编写自己的头文件时,一般包含以下内容()A头文件开头处的文件信息声明B预处理语句块C函数和类结构声明D函数和类结构定义正确答案是:ABC2、C++将内存划分为三个逻辑区域,分别为:()A栈B队列C堆D静态存储区正确答案是:ACD三、判断题共10题,40

6、分1、继承可以使得对象以外的部分不能随意存取对象的内部数据,从而实现信息隐藏。A错误B正确正确答案是:A2、在类体内实现的成员函数也是内联函数。A错误B正确正确答案是:B3、在C++语言中,函数重载是通过静态联编实现的。A错误B正确正确答案是:B4、继承可以使得一个类可以直接获得另一个类的性质和特征。A错误B正确正确答案是:B5、当使用基类或内层类的带参数的构造函数来完成基类成员或对象成员的初始化时,有时候不需要定义派生类的构造函数。A错误B正确正确答案是:A6、在C++中虚函数帮助实现了类的多态性A错误B正确

7、正确答案是:B7、程序的编译是以文件为单位的,因此将程序分到多个文件中可以减少每次对程序修改所带来的编译工作量A错误B正确正确答案是:B8、当将一个类S定义为零一个类A的友元类时,类S的所有成员函数都可以直接访问类A的所有成员A错误B正确正确答案是:B9、虚函数由成员函数调用或通过指针,引用来访问。A错误B正确正确答案是:B10、没有返回值或者返回值为空是一回事。A错误B正确正确答案是:A

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。